About OCP

The Open Compute Project (OCP) is the engine driving the future of data centers, AI, and a broad spectrum of computational infrastructure. We don't just innovate technology - we accelerate progress by making technology open, efficient, scalable and sustainable. We believe that by building a community where the world's leading experts and companies collaborate, we can solve the grand challenges of computational infrastructure faster than any single organization can alone.

Our team is here to lead a universally beneficial, open platform for next-generation technology.

We succeed through transparency, deep collaboration and a relentless focus on community engagement. As a non-profit foundation, our success is measured by the connections we build, the participation we inspire, and the innovations that result from our member’s collective work. We create the framework, the programs, the events, and the processes that transform ideas into impact.
